Finally, the `schemas` folder contains all the schema pages. You might notice that the schema folder is not present in GitHub. This is because the schema pages are auto-generated from the schema files in `../NewHorizons/Schemas`. In order to edit these you need to edit the C# class they correspond to. More info in the main contributing document found one folder up.
